WebNov 20, 2020 · Heat oven to 350 degrees. Place pecans on a baking sheet and toast for 3-4 minutes until brown. Remove from oven and let cool. . …

1. Heat oven to 350 degrees. Place pecans on a baking sheet and toast for 3-4 minutes until brown. Remove from oven and let cool.
2. In a medium-size saucepan, over medium heat, melt butter. Add brown sugar and maple syrup and stir until smooth. Bring the mixture up to a simmer then remove from heat. Place in a bowl to cool for 10 minutes.
3. Whisk eggs and add to the butter-sugar mixture. Add in bourbon, vanilla, and salt whisking together until well blended. Pour mixture into uncooked pie shell. Place toasted pecans on top of the sugar fulling. Place pie on a baking sheet. Lightly spray a piece of foil with cooking spray and place over pie. Bake pie in the oven for 20 minutes. Remove foil and bake for an additional 20-25 minutes until the edges of the pie are set. The center will be slightly jiggly but will set when cooled.
4. Remove pie from oven and place on a wire rack to cool. Sprinkle with flakey sea salt. Best served at room temperature.
